so i was talking with my tech buddy at **** after scanning my car for codes and checking misfire history (lots of misfires by the way) and he asked what fuel i was running. told him 91 and he told me not to use it in the winter time as it requires more heat/energy to burn and on the cold start ups it will misfire. so next tank i'm gonna switch back to 87 and see if that helps with the misfires on cold start ups.

As long as your timing isnt advanced then you should be fine on 87. But if u bumped the timing up, i suggest staying 91. Theres plenty of things that can cause a misfire. Could be the fuel, air, ignition coils, spark plugs, tune itself.

There's not really much of a choice out ther unfortunatly. I would just install on your stock struts when you get them and then when they go either install koni inserts ( looks like a Pain in the ass install but are good) or get some struts from a new tc, sounds like they are really good. You can get the entire suspension package from crate engine depot for 330 ( struts and rear shocks). Or bite the bullet and go with coil overs. What ever you do dont order from a dealership in town for the struts as they are a fortune. ( +200 each when i priced out)
